Transaction 84316d15f535e30d91dabf69bb2016c844618762c839d25624fde257d624ae8c
1 Input
1 Output
-
84316d15f535e30d91dabf69bb2016c844618762c839d25624fde257d624ae8c:0
- value
- 643799
- script pubkey
- OP_0 OP_PUSHBYTES_20 183c42b38aca0d880d7fa40c3d98c9dd5d963f7c
- address
- bc1qrq7y9vu2egxcsrtl5sxrmxxfm4wev0muvtjal6